Multiple versions of Samba have a critical remote code execution vulnerability. Attackers can upload a shared library to a writable share and get the server to execute it. Samba is a Linux implementation of the SMB protocol used by Windows for file sharing. As of Thursday, there are some 627,000 systems running Samba that are accessible via the Internet. The US-CERT urges users and administrators to apply the patches or work with their Linux or Unix vendors to patch vulnerable systems.”]
